We consider the problem of Arnold's diffusion for nearly integrable isochronous Hamiltonian systems. We prove a shadowing theorem which improves the known estimates for the diffusion time. We also develop a new method for measuring the splitting of the separatrices. As an application we justify, for three time scales systems, that the splitting is correctly predicted by the Poincaré-Melnikov function.
